The precise amount of time in Earth days it takes for each planet to complete its orbit … WebApr 24, 2024 · The 1965 observations showed that Mercury completes one of its rotations in 58.65 Earth days. This figure is two-thirds of the time that Mercury takes to complete one orbit of the Sun. Astronomers use the term "spin-orbit resonance" to describe the ratio of a rotation on a planet's axis to the time it needs to complete an orbit of the Sun. essence of divination wow

WebThe disk of stars in the Milky Way is about 100,000 light years across and the sun is located about 30,000 light years from the galaxy's center. Based on a distance of 30,000 light years and a speed of 220 km/s, the Sun's orbit around the center of the Milky Way once every 225 million years. The period of time is called a cosmic year. WebTo complete a solar day, Earth must rotate an additional amount, equal to 1/365 of a full turn. The time required for this extra rotation is 1/365 of a day, or about 4 minutes. So the solar day is about 4 minutes longer than the sidereal day. Figure 1: Difference Between a Sidereal Day and a Solar Day. This is a top view, looking down as Earth ...

WebEquinoctial precession is a circular motion of Earth's rotational axis with respect to the "fixed" stars, also known as lunisolar precession. It is caused by the torque of the Sun and Moon on the Earth's rotational bulge. The axis precesses with a period of approximately 25,770 y (Beatty et al. 1990).
